In addition, there are many chances to go dumpster diving in wealthy areas such as Beverly Hills, East Grand Rapids, Birmingham, Milan, and Grosse Pointe.Wear pants and tops with long sleeves to minimize your exposure to unsanitary messes. If you’re going to actually enter the dumpster, wear sturdy fabrics like denim, nylon or leather and keep as much of your body covered as possible. In Oklahoma, dumpster diving is not illegal. Dumpster diving is, in fact, perfectly permitted in this state. You must, however, follow your state's trespassing laws as well as the ordinances and statutes of the city or municipality. Dumpster Diving at Big Corporate Stores for u Yes, it is legal to dumpster dive in Pennsylvania. However, there are limitations to this practice. For example, individuals may not enter private property to access a dumpster. Additionally, if a dumpster is located on private property and is marked with "No Trespassing" or "No Dumping" signs, it is illegal to access the dumpster ...
